Security Agencies Prevent Crisis in Oro Kingdom Over Planned Church Disruption

Date: 2024-12-01

Security forces on Sunday averted a major unrest in Oro Kingdom, in Irepodun Local Government Area of Kwara State.

Intelligence reports reaching DAILY POST indicated that a group in the community planned to cause a crisis at the Catholic Church in the town, where the traditional ruler, Oba Joel Olaniyi Oyetoye Olufayo II, also intended to worship.

Consequently, the church was put under lock and key by the aggrieved section of the community to avert any bloody clash that could have been triggered by the development.

The spokesman of the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ps (NSCDC), Kwara State Command, Ayoola Michael Shola, confirmed the development to DAILY POST in Ilorin on Sunday.

He said the proactive action taken by the security forces helped to reduce the tension between some members of the community and the monarch.

“A combined team of the Police, DSS, and NSCDC is at the church to protect lives and property, while the facility is under lock and key,” he added.
